Atkins Diet - A Fad?

Just think about this logically for a moment.
Diets like the ones marketed -yes marketed, because each of these diets is a brand, a product that you are being asked to buy - by Atkins, the South Beach product-makers, and others emphasizing low or almost no carbohydrates, are asking you to believe the impossible.
The claim that "a diet rich in fats without carbohydrates will lead to stunning weight loss" sounds too good to be true, because it is - at least in the long run.
Sure, as your body goes into shock without the critical addition of carbs you will lose some weight, but this diet is not sustainable - it is very, very difficult to adhere to in the long-run.
That short-term weight- and fat-loss is the only dramatic effect you will experience.
This type of diet, scientifically dubbed "ketogenic", forces the body to turn to fat stores to burn in the absence of energy from carbs.
It should be noted that the word ketogenic is also related to the serious illness ketosis, which is the buildup of harmful acids in the bloodstream, something that can occur with long-term adherence to a diet of this sort.
You may be losing weight at first, but a great deal of it is water.
Furthermore, your body catches on to the changes that are happening and slows your metabolism accordingly - not a good thing.
You are now stuck with a lowered metabolism and a diet that is designed to fail without the strictest adherence for the long haul.
And honestly, who can really adhere to these diets for several years?
